He’s not a central character in the Bible – he doesn’t have a main story line. He’s never the star but he does an awesome job in his supporting role.
Caleb shows up as Joshua’s sidekick a couple of times and every time he’s right on target. He is always choosing to believe what God has promised. He is willing to take God’s word and act on it. He’s brave. He doesn’t forget what God has already done in his life. He’s consistent.
Later in the Old Testament we see Caleb’s brother, Othniel, being chosen by God to be a judge who delivers the Israelites from oppression for over 40 years.
The parents of Caleb and Othniel really did a good job! When their boys show up in Scripture, they are being noble and leading the way as they follow God.
